Sport and solidarity have been walking together for 16 years thanks to the event "Navicula Turritana and Sport for Research" which, having abandoned the old name of Barcolana, has not forgotten its charitable purpose. The event, organized by the Fidapa section of Porto Torres, is scheduled for Friday 28 and Saturday 29 July, starting at 5 pm, in the various locations chosen for the conduct of the sports tournaments and at the Scogliolungo, on the Turritan seafront, where the lights of the Torchlight procession will come on.

An initiative that retains its charm for the large chain of torches that from the canoes will reflect the light on the sea of the opposite beach. No referees are needed because there is no competitive spirit, just pure fun and solidarity. "The event was born in 2007 to raise funds to finance a donation to be allocated to research for the study of rare diseases, in memory of the partner Dr. Elisabetta Fara - explains Cristina Benenati, local president of Fidapa - this year the proceeds will be destined to the Porto Torres Consultory, gynecology and obstetrics clinics".

Various sports disciplines, from the more traditional team games to individual sports and the participation of the Piscine Libyssonis association, Asso Vela, Azen Kayak, the Italian Naval League, Gulf of Asinara section - Giuseppe Usai Rowing Group, Porto Torres Tennis Club, ASD Porto Torres Scacchi, Freedom Water Ssd association, Asd. Quadrifoglio Volleyball, Cngei Scout Porto Torres and Porto Torres Volunteer Consultation.

«The Navicula Turritana – underlined the Councilor for Sport and Tourism, Simona Fois – involves different realities of the territory, a synergy of associations that work together for a common goal. We are proud that this event is proposed once again in the city». Sporting events include table tennis tournaments, aqua fitness, volleyball, swimming, spinning, chess and table football tournaments.
